New User Registration

If you are a new user, you will need to register to set up your account. The system will ask you for some personal details to confirm who you are. This includes your first name, your last name, your city, and your zip code. These pieces of information must match the guardian information that Humble ISD has on file from your student’s initial registration. This match is very important, basically, for security reasons.

The registration process helps ensure that only authorized parents or guardians can access a student's private academic records. It's a security measure that helps keep student information safe. So, making sure your details are correct when you register is, in a way, a key step to getting access.

Once you provide the required information and it matches the district's records, you will be able to create your user name and password. This is your personal entry point into the system. HAC Humble for Returning vs. Newly Enrolled Students

The way students interact with HAC Humble can vary slightly depending on whether they are returning to Humble ISD or are newly enrolled. A returning student is any student who was actively enrolled in the district on a previous occasion. For these students, their records are already in the system, making access fairly straightforward. So, their process is, in a way, more streamlined.

For newly enrolled students, it is not required for them to have an immediate HAC account. The system focuses on getting their initial registration details correct first. Parents of newly enrolled students will typically set up their guardian HAC accounts after the student's enrollment is complete and their information is fully processed.
